What is cyclohexyl acetate used for?
Cyclohexyl Acetate is a colorless, oily liquid with a fruity odor. It is used as a solvent and as a synthetic flavor in food.

Is cyclohexyl acetate an ester?
Cyclohexyl acetate is a carboxylic ester.

Identification of CYCLOHEXYL ACETATE Chemical Compound
Chemical Formula | C8H14O2 |
---|---|
Molecular Weight | 142.19556 g/mol |
IUPAC Name | cyclohexyl acetate |
SMILES String | CC(=O)OC1CCCCC1 |
InChI | InChI=1S/C8H14O2/c1-7(9)10-8-5-3-2-4-6-8/h8H,2-6H2,1H3 |

Why is cyclohexylamine toxic?
The corrosive effect of cyclohexylamine is due to its alkalinity; sympathomimetic and cardiovascular effects have been described for it (Barger and Dal 1910). In addition, it releases catecholamine and histamine (Miyata et al. 1969).
Is cyclohexylamine volatile?
Cyclohexylamine strongly prefers the steam phase while morpholine has a relatively volatility close to that of water. Thus, common reagents used are amines such as ammonia, morpholine, and cyclohexylamine.
